What is the best shed floor plywood thickness, Size and type of plywood for your shed floor. letâs take a look at what 3/4 inch pressure-treated cdx plywood is and why you want it. the 3/4 inch thick plywood is sturdy.it can support the weight of a person and heavier equipment without fatiguing over time..

How to lay a gravel shed foundation - an everyday, Use a âscreedâ (which is a fancy name for a length of wood that reaches from one side of your timber frame to the other) to level the top of the gravel shed foundation. the screed will help reduce the high spots in your gravel by moving the excess gravel into the low spots, filling them in..
